Overview of the Book and Its Impact
The 4-Hour Workweek, Expanded and Updated by Timothy Ferriss has become a groundbreaking guide for redefining work-life balance․ Initially rejected by 26 publishers, it has since spent seven years on The New York Times bestseller list, proving its transformative impact․ The book challenges traditional retirement concepts and introduces the idea of the “New Rich,” a group that prioritizes lifestyle design over income accumulation․ Ferriss shares practical strategies for eliminating time-wasters, outsourcing tasks, and creating automated income streams․ The expanded edition includes over 100 pages of new content, featuring cutting-edge tools and real-life success stories․ It has inspired millions to rethink their approach to work, wealth, and fulfillment, making it a modern manifesto for lifestyle freedom․

The Four-Step Process: Definition, Elimination, Automation, Liberation
The four-step process outlined in The 4-Hour Workweek guides readers toward creating a lifestyle of freedom and wealth․ Definition involves identifying and challenging assumptions about work and life, setting clear goals․ Elimination focuses on removing obstacles, such as time-wasting activities, to maximize productivity․ Automation is about building systems to handle income generation and tasks, reducing manual effort․ Finally, Liberation empowers individuals to break free from geographical and financial constraints, enabling them to live life on their terms․ This structured approach helps readers transition from a traditional 9-to-5 grind to a life of luxury and fulfillment․

How Tim Ferriss Transitioned to a 4-Hour Workweek
Tim Ferriss’s journey to a 4-hour workweek began with a dramatic shift in mindset and strategy․ He moved from earning $40,000 annually with 80-hour workweeks to generating $40,000 monthly with just 4 hours of work per week․ Ferriss achieved this by implementing the four-step process outlined in his book: Definition, Elimination, Automation, and Liberation․ He eliminated time-wasting activities, outsourced tasks, and created automated income streams․ The expanded edition shares detailed insights into how he applied these principles, offering readers a step-by-step guide to replicating his success and achieving financial freedom․
